LNC or Executive Committee Meeting minutes may be promoted from draft status to official during the time between meetings as follows:
• Draft minutes shall be mailed or emailed to all LNC Members not more than twenty (20) days after each meeting.
• Corrections, clarifications, and changes to the draft minutes may be submitted for the Secretary's consideration for a period of fifteen (15) days following the distribution of the draft minutes. The Secretary shall distribute an updated version of the draft minutes not later than seven (7) days following the end of that submission period. If no changes are distributed during that period, the minutes shall be promoted from draft to final.
• The updated version shall be deemed official if no LNC Member challenges the content to the Secretary within seven (7) days of the distribution of the updated version. Only Executive Committee members can present challenges to Executive Committee minutes. Any additional changes will be made by the Secretary within two (2) days and distributed for an additional seven (7) day review period. This process shall repeat until there are no challenges or the next regular LNC meeting, whichever comes first.
